Density and movements of the coati in Arizona
Lanning DV. 1976. Density and movements of the coati in Arizona. Journal of Mammalogy. 57(3):609-611
This article reports on the density and movements of coati mundi during 1973 and 1974 in and near Chiricahua National Monument. Coatis were observed by the author and sightings by personnel and visitors were recorded. Animals were captured in traps set along Bonita Canyon. Individuals were tagged and radio transmitter collars were attached to two males. Figure.
